| Biochem/physiol Actions: |
SMARt-420 (Small Molecule Aborting Resistance) activates an alternative bioactivation pathway of the tuberculosis antibiotic pro-drug ethionamide. Ethionamide bioactivation is normally catalyzed by monooxygenase EthA, but mutations in the enzyme have allowed many strains to become resistant. SMARt-420 activates a previously unknown pathway, reversing ethionamide-acquired resistance and clearing ethionamide-resistant infection in mice in addition to increasing the sensitivity of bacteria to ethionamide. |
